Crossing The Alameda

Bronco Class of 1991

Join Gen Xer's from the Santa Clara University Class of 1991 as they take you on a life adventure from the Analog Era to the Digital Era. Each episode revisits our SCU days and explores the winding paths we’ve taken since. Crossing The Alameda is both a campus callback and a metaphor for moving forward, together. Expect plenty of laughter, along with thoughtful, vulnerable reflections on the lives we’ve built since.

    Crossing The Alameda - featuring Amy Baird Depner and Michelle Qualls Radley

    In this episode of Crossing the Alameda, hosts A.J. Riebli and Kari Morin reconnect with alumni Amy Baird Depner and Michelle Qualls Radley from the class of 1991. They reminisce about their time at Santa Clara University, discussing how they chose the school, their friendship origins, memorable college stories, and the challenges of maintaining connections post-graduation. The conversation also delves into Amy's experience as a member of the women's soccer team during its formative years, highlighting the evolution of the sport and the camaraderie built among teammates. In this engaging conversation, the speakers reflect on their experiences balancing sports and academics during college, the impact of memorable professors, and the life lessons learned along the way. They share humorous anecdotes from their time on the Team USA road trip, highlighting the importance of friendship and adventure. The discussion also delves into their career paths in education and physical therapy, emphasizing the fulfillment and challenges of working in helping professions. In this engaging conversation, the speakers discuss their experiences in leadership roles within healthcare and education, emphasizing the importance of supporting clinicians and teachers. They reflect on the balance between professional responsibilities and personal life, highlighting the significance of family and community connections. The discussion also touches on career aspirations, the value of mentorship, and the wisdom gained over the years, culminating in heartfelt advice to their younger selves.     Crossing The Alameda - featuring Iris Corenevsky

    In this episode of Crossing the Alameda, host A.J. Riebli and guests Mike Klein, Kari Morin, and Charles Michelet reconnect with Iris Corenevsky, a fellow Santa Clara University alumna from the class of 1991. The conversation explores Iris's journey from a math major to a philosophy graduate, her memorable experiences at SCU, and her diverse career path that includes roles in massage therapy and tech leadership. Iris shares insights on the importance of community, personal reinvention, and her current work in fostering a positive workplace culture. The discussion also touches on her passions for reading and baking, as well as her involvement in the virtual world of Second Life. In this engaging conversation, the participants explore a variety of themes including culinary adventures, favorite books in the sci-fi and fantasy genres, personal insights through a fun Fast Five segment, and reflections on life aspirations.     Crossing The Alameda - featuring Pam Rozolis Ortega

    In this episode of Crossing the Alameda, hosts Mike Kline, Kari Morin, and Charles Michelet reconnect with fellow classmate Pam Rosolis Ortega from the class of 1991. They reminisce about their time at Santa Clara University, sharing vivid memories of college life, influential experiences, and personal growth. Pam discusses her journey from aspiring TV news reporter to nonprofit work, her career path, and the challenges she faced as a breast cancer survivor. The conversation highlights the importance of community, health, and the lasting impact of their college years. In this heartfelt conversation, Pam Rozolis Ortega shares her journey through cancer, the lessons learned about life and health, and the transition to an empty nest. She emphasizes the importance of self-care, cherishing friendships, and creating a bucket list of experiences to enjoy while still healthy. Pam also reflects on her past, offering advice to her younger self about exploring interests and not being afraid to try new things.     Crossing The Alameda - featuring Dr. Cynthia Brunet Keller

    In this episode of Crossing the Alameda, the hosts welcome Dr. Cynthia Keller, a distinguished alumna of Santa Clara University. Cynthia shares her deep-rooted connection to the university, her academic journey, and the challenges she faced along the way. From her early memories on campus to her experiences in medical school, Cynthia's story is one of resilience, support from influential faculty, and the importance of community. She also shares her love story with Andy Keller, highlighting the personal aspects of her life that have shaped her career and values. In this engaging conversation, Cynthia Keller shares her journey through medical training, the challenges she faced, and the pivotal role her partner played in her personal and professional growth. She discusses her transition to integrative medicine, emphasizing the importance of nutrition and holistic care, especially in the context of the COVID-19 pandemic. Cynthia also highlights her innovative approaches to pediatric care, including the development of a supplement aimed at addressing nutritional deficiencies exacerbated by COVID-19, and the profound impact of these changes on her patients and their families. In this engaging conversation, Cynthia Keller shares personal insights through a fun segment called the Fast Five, reflecting on her life, career, and the importance of community. She offers advice to her younger self, emphasizing the reassurance that everything will be okay. The discussion highlights the significance of reconnecting with others and sharing stories, as well as exploring professional journeys in wellness and nutrition. Cynthia's passion for helping others and her experiences in the medical field are also explored, showcasing her dedication to making a positive impact.
